DoubleClick counts on Abacus

By Joey Gardiner, 15 June 1999 16:26

NEWS Internet advertising specialist, DoubleClick, is to merge with direct marketer, Abacus, owner of the largest proprietary database of consumer information in the US. The combined company, valued at $1bn, will retain the DoubleClick name. DoubleClick said Abacus will boost its Internet marketing strategy by adding top-quality market information to DoubleClick's technology and media penetration. Meanwhile, DoubleClick announced an alliance with Beenz.com, the two month-old online currency company. Beenz claims to be able to turn Web surfers into e-shoppers by giving them electronic credits for activities performed online.
